ERIndex.IndexAttribute Class Reference

Collaboration diagram for ERIndex.IndexAttribute:

Collaboration graph
[legend]

List of all members.

Public Member Functions

Analyzer analyzer ()
String formatValue (Object value)
Index index ()
String name ()
Store store ()
TermVector termVector ()

Package Functions

 IndexAttribute (ERIndex index, String name, NSDictionary dict)

Package Attributes

Analyzer _analyzer
Format _format
Index _index
ERIndex _model
String _name
Store _store
TermVector _termVector

Private Member Functions

Object classValue (NSDictionary dict, String key, Class c, String defaultValue)
Object create (String className)


Constructor & Destructor Documentation

IndexAttribute ( ERIndex  index,
String  name,
NSDictionary  dict 
) [package]

This class corresponds to one property. indexModel --> properties --> a property

Parameters:
index the index
name the property name (a key or keypath)
dict the property definition form indexModel


Member Function Documentation

Analyzer analyzer (  ) 

Object classValue ( NSDictionary  dict,
String  key,
Class  c,
String  defaultValue 
) [private]

Object create ( String  className  )  [private]

String formatValue ( Object  value  ) 

Index index (  ) 

String name (  ) 

Store store (  ) 

TermVector termVector (  ) 


Member Data Documentation

Analyzer _analyzer [package]

Format _format [package]

Index _index [package]

ERIndex _model [package]

String _name [package]

Store _store [package]

TermVector _termVector [package]


The documentation for this class was generated from the following file:

Generated on Sat May 26 06:43:20 2012 for Project Wonder by  doxygen 1.5.8